Zara’s Collision Center Receives Ford F-150 Aluminum-Alloy APN Certification

Zara’s certifications by Assured Performance Collision Care also include Fiat Chrysler Automobiles, General Motors and Enterprise.

zara-logoBrad Zara, president of Zara’s Collision Center, announced that the facility has been recognized by Ford Motor Co. as a collision repair facility certified by Assured Performance Collision Care.

“We take great pride in the F-150 certification,” said Zara. “The 2015 F-150s have aluminum-alloy bodies and steel frames. Drivers in this area who own those vehicles now have a local, certified repair facility for their convenience should an accident occur.”

Less than 5 percent of collision repair shops nationally have met the Assured Performance criteria. The certification assures that Zara’s possesses the proper tools, equipment, facilities and trained staff required to repair vehicles to the manufacturers’ specifications so that the fit, finish, durability, value and safety of the vehicles are ensured.

Zara’s is the only Springfield, Ill.-area body shop to have the Assured Performance certifications, and the only facility in the Springfield area to be certified as a Honda Motor Co. ProFirst collision repair shop.

“This means that customers can expect a VIP, white-glove treatment backed by lifetime warranty of the repair,” said Zara.
